Impact
Adobe Commerce, including its B2B extension, the Webhooks Plugin, and Magento Open Source, are affected by an incorrect authorization flaw that allows an attacker to bypass security controls without any user interaction. The vulnerability enables unauthorized read and write access to protected resources, exposing sensitive data and permitting unauthorized modification, as indicated by CWE‑863.
Affected Systems
All installations of Adobe Commerce, Adobe Commerce B2B, Adobe Commerce Webhooks Plugin, and Magento Open Source are impacted. Version information is not provided in the advisory, so any version released before an official patch should be considered vulnerable.
Risk and Exploitability
The flaw carries a CVSS score of 8.2, classifying it as high severity, and an EPSS score of less than 1%, indicating that exploitation is currently unlikely. It is not listed in the CISA KEV catalog. Based on the description, it is inferred that the attacker can exploit the vulnerability remotely via exposed API endpoints, without requiring user interaction.
